In the fast-paced world of business, data is the lifeblood that fuels informed decision-making and drives organisational success. As businesses evolve and grow, the need for data migration becomes inevitable. Whether you’re transitioning to a new system, consolidating databases, or adopting cloud solutions, the accuracy of your data during migration is paramount. In this blog, we’ll explore the best practices to ensure data accuracy during migration, helping you avoid pitfalls and optimise the value of your data assets.
Comprehensive Data Assessment
Before embarking on any data migration project, conduct a thorough assessment of your existing data landscape. Understand the types of data, their interdependencies, and the quality of the data. Identify redundant, obsolete, or trivial (ROT) data that can be eliminated, and establish a baseline for data quality metrics. This step lays the foundation for a successful migration strategy.
Data Cleansing and Standardisation
Clean and standardised data is the bedrock of accuracy. Implement data cleansing processes to rectify inconsistencies, errors, and inaccuracies in your
data. Standardise formats, eliminate duplicate records, and ensure that data adheres to defined conventions. Consistency in data structure and content facilitates a smoother migration process and enhances the reliability of the migrated data.
Define Clear Data Migration Objectives
Establish clear objectives for your data migration project. Clearly define what success looks like, including specific criteria for data accuracy. Outline the scope, timeline, and resources required for the migration. Having a well-defined roadmap helps in aligning the team and ensures that everyone is working towards a common goal.
Implement Data Validation Protocols
During migration, implement robust data validation protocols to verify the accuracy of transferred data. Use checksums, hash functions, or validation rules to ensure that data integrity is maintained throughout the migration process. Regularly validate data at various stages to catch and rectify discrepancies promptly.
Real-time Monitoring and Reporting
Deploy real-time monitoring tools that provide visibility into the migration process. Continuous monitoring allows you to detect anomalies, track progress, and identify potential issues before they escalate. Implement reporting mechanisms to generate detailed insights into data accuracy, allowing for quick corrective actions when necessary.
Data Quality Assurance Testing
Conduct rigorous quality assurance (QA) testing to validate the accuracy of migrated data. Develop test scenarios that mimic real-world usage and assess the performance of the migrated data under various conditions. Engage stakeholders in user acceptance testing (UAT) to ensure that the data meets business requirements and expectations.
Data Migration Validation by Stakeholders
Involve key stakeholders in the validation process. Encourage users to validate and cross-verify the migrated data against their expectations. Their input is invaluable in identifying any overlooked nuances and ensuring that the data accurately represents the business reality.
Rollback Plan and Contingency Measures
Prepare for the unexpected by developing a rollback plan and contingency measures. In the event of data inaccuracies or unforeseen issues, having a well-defined plan to revert to the previous state is crucial. Additionally, establish contingency measures to address any challenges that may arise during the migration process.
Conclusion
Data migration is a complex process that demands meticulous planning and execution. By adhering to these best practices, business leaders can navigate the challenges of data migration with confidence, ensuring the accuracy and reliability of their data assets. In an era where data-driven decision-making is non-negotiable, investing in a robust data migration strategy is an investment in the future success of your business.
Need help with data migration?
At Tech Consultants, we pride ourselves on offering comprehensive solutions that ensure a smooth transition for your valuable data. Our expert team is dedicated to making the migration process effortless, whether you are upgrading systems, consolidating databases, or moving to a new platform.
Get in touch with us today!